Modern coinage, likely related to water or the name Yareli
Yarexi is a modern American name of uncertain origin, likely created as a variation of Yareli or Yaritzel. It is particularly popular within Hispanic communities in the United States, often blending traditional sounds with a contemporary suffix. While its exact etymology is not established, it is frequently associated with the element of water through its phonetic similarity to names like Yareli.
